Default Re: assembly manual measurements

I would not use any assembly manual dimensions for anything. I once used the 69 manual, to lay out the holes for the Camaro emblem on both fenders on a piece of paper. Then I made a template off an original emblem to precisely locate the pins, and overlaid it over the holes. One side had the emblem slightly rising, and the other side had the emblem slightly dropping.

I'd make a template with pin locations on a piece of poster board (I used a cereal box) tape it to the fender, and step back 10 feet, to look at it. Adjust until you like it, and drill pilot holes. Then drill or file with a jewelers file until it fits.
